Captain Luke Wright has been ruled out of Sussex’s opening County Championship match at Northamptonshire with a back injury.

Wright aggravated a long-standing problem on the flight home from New Zealand last month and missed the two friendly matches against Surrey and Hampshire.

The former England international did play in the three-day game against Leeds/Bradford MCCU after declaring his fitness for the start of the season but has suffered a relapse.

It means vice-captain Ben Brown will lead the side for the first time as Sussex bid to improve their poor record at Wantage Road where they have only won once in their last 15 visits.

Brown will lead a Sussex side also missing experienced batsman Chris Nash with Harry Finch - who made a century against Leeds/Bradford MCCU - getting an opportunity.

Teenage seamer George Garton will also make his County Championship debut after being preferred to Lewis Hatchett while spinner Danny Briggs plays in a five-man bowling attack. 

Overnight rain has delayed the start until 11.30am with Brown electing to bowl first under new ECB rules.
